ABSTRACT

Objective To determine the contributions of main chemical compositions of extracts of Eucalyptus camaldulensis represented by GC/MS elute peaks to the molluscicidal activities,and explore a shortcut of looking for the effective components from natural products. Methods E. camaldulensis leaves were collected consecutively in 12 months at the same place,extracted with dichloromethane,analyzed by GC/MS,and their LC50(s)of molluscicidal activities were tested according to the method rec-ommended by WHO. The correlation of the main components in 12 extracts and their molluscicidal activities were analyzed by the grey relative correlation analysis model with software GTMS 3.0. Result All the dichloromethane extracts of eucalyptus leaves showed excellent molluscicidal activities with the highest LC50 of 0.257mg/L and 0.242mg/L for the samples in June and July and the lowest LC50 of 6.802 mg/L and 5.406 mg/L in December and January respectively. The structures of 16 main chemical compo-nents were elucidated by GC/MS and NIST Mass Spectral Library,most of which were monoterpenes and sesquiterpenoids. The gray correlation coefficients with activity were all over 0.5,the first five over 0.9 were 4,4,8-Trimethyltricyclo[6.3.1.0(1,5)]do-decane-2,9-diol,(-)-Spathulenol,a structural isomer of(-)-Spathulenol,Eucalyptol and Ledol. Conclusion The most main in-gredients in the dichloromethane extracts of E. camaldulensis leaves show good correlations with the molluscicidal activity,which suggests that the molluscicidal role is synergistically played by the multiple components together.

ABSTRACT

Mebendazole is currently used in the treatment of hydatid disease.Its poor absorption from the gastro-intestinal tract and low bioavailability aroused further research on new formulations of mebendazole to increase the bioa-vailability and improve the therapeutic efficacy.This review summarizes the recent research progress.

ABSTRACT

Object To determine the content of muscone in preparation Methods Standard addition, DNP derivatization and HPLC with electrospray ionization tandem mass spectrometry (LC/ESI MS/MS) were utilized Results Identification of muscone hydrazone in the sample was based on the unique mass spectra of the standard Under an optimum condition peak corresponding to + ion and characteristic fragments for muscone hydrazone were observed ESI and APCI full scan m/z 419 MS/MS had the same relative molecular mass and fragmentation pattern The recovery was 102 5% with RSD ≤ 2 76% (n=5) Conclusion The qualitative and quantitative determination on muscone could be fulfilled simultaneously
